9 " mL of " a mixture of methane and ethylene was exploded with 30 mL (excess) of oxygen. After cooling, the volume was 21.0 mL. Further treatment with caustic potash solution reduced the volume to 7.0 mL. Determine the composition of the mixture.

A

5 mL of `CH_4 + 4 mL of C_2H_4`

B

4 mL of `CH_4 +5 mL of C_2H_4`

C

3 mL of `CH_4 +6 mL of C_2H_4`

D

6 mL of `CH_4 +3 mL of C_2H_4`

Text Solution

Verified by Experts

The correct Answer is:
B

`underset(x mL)(CH_(4)+2O_(2)) rarr underset(x mL )(CO_(2)+ 2H_(2)O)`
`underset((9.0-x)mL )(C_(2)H_(4)+3O_(2))rarrunderset((9.0-x)mL)(2CO_(2)+2H_(2)O`
Volume of `Co_92)` Produced =x+2(9.0-x)
Actual volume of `CO_(2)` Produced
=(21.0-7.0)mL = 14 mL
`therefore x + 18-2x=14`
x=4
`therefore` Vol. of `CH_(4)`=x mL = 4mL
`therefore " vol. of " C_(2)H_(4)=(9.0=x)mL `
=(9-4)mL = 5 mL
